Re: How to use Dualboot in Pr 1.3?

You don't have to remove the battery to change the microSD in the N900, only the back cover. You do need to remove the battery to change the SIM card, though.

Re: Where is the contact list stored?

It's stored in the files in /home/user/.osso-abook/db/, but the files are encrypted

Re: How much data used by GPS?

AGPS should only need the few kB the first time it connects, when it gets a satellite signal it can get the remaining info from there.
